    Carmine

    Carmine

    Redis client and message queue for Clojure

    ...It deserves a great Clojure client. Fully documented, API with full support for the latest Redis versions. Industrial strength connection pooling. Composable, first-class command functions. Flexible, high-performance binary-safe serialization using Nippy. Simple, high-performance message queue (v2+, Redis 2.6+). Simple, high-performance distributed lock (v2+, Redis 2.6+). Pluggable compression and encryption support (v2+). Includes Tundra, an API for replicating data to an additional datastore (v2+, Redis 2.6+). ...

    Redis Client for Crystal

    Redis Client for Crystal

    Full featured Redis client for Crystal

    A Redis client for the Crystal programming language. This Redis instance can be shared across fibers and accepts the same Redis commands as the Redis class. It automatically allocates and frees connections from/to the pool, per command.
